Commitment to genuine Eaton components giving rebuilder edge on competitors

Capital Gear Ltd., a transmission rebuilder and aftermarket parts seller based in Edmonton, Alberta, faced intense price pressure from competitors using cheaper jobber parts. To stand out on quality and keep its technicians productive, the company needed a dependable parts strategy. Eaton provided the genuine components Capital Gear relied on, including Eaton Fuller gears and bearings, rebuilt and new Eaton transmissions, and Eaton Advantage Series clutches.

By switching exclusively to genuine Eaton parts, Capital Gear improved transmission durability, strengthened its reputation for quality, and saw its business grow. The company reported that its transmissions now outlast competitors’ units, leading to more repeat customers and increased sales. According to Capital Gear, Eaton’s quality, warranty support, and OEM-level components helped make the business “bigger and stronger.”
